Hướng dẫn sử dụng

Mods Client-Side Là Gì ?

Client-side trong Minecraft là gì? Vì sao bạn nên biết?

Trong Minecraft, Client-side là tất cả những gì chỉ chạy trên máy tính của người chơi (Client), thay vì chạy trên máy chủ (Server). Nói cách khác, đây là mọi thứ chỉ ảnh hưởng đến trải nghiệm của riêng bạn mà không tác động trực tiếp đến thế giới trên máy chủ.

Khi tham gia một máy chủ Minecraft, Server sẽ gửi dữ liệu về thế giới như Block, Entity và các thông tin cần thiết. Sau đó, Client của bạn sẽ xử lý và hiển thị những dữ liệu đó thành hình ảnh, âm thanh, giao diện và các hiệu ứng mà bạn nhìn thấy.

Có thể hiểu đơn giản:

Client-side là những gì bạn nhìn thấy và thao tác trên màn hình.


Client-side khác gì với Server-side?

Trong các bài hướng dẫn về Mod hoặc Minecraft Hosting, bạn sẽ thường thấy hai khái niệm:

20260702_YQkOr7gHplTb2x2BF24m.png

Client-side và Server-side

Mặc dù nghe khá giống nhau nhưng chúng đảm nhiệm hai vai trò hoàn toàn khác nhau.

Server-side

Server-side là nơi quyết định mọi thứ diễn ra trong thế giới Minecraft, chẳng hạn như:

  • Block có thực sự bị phá hay không.
  • Mob có thực sự chết hay không.
  • Đòn đánh có trúng mục tiêu hay không.
  • Vật phẩm có được thêm vào túi đồ hay không.

Nếu Server xác nhận không, thì dù Client của bạn có hiển thị khác trong chốc lát, kết quả cuối cùng vẫn sẽ theo Server.


Client-side

Client-side chịu trách nhiệm hiển thị toàn bộ dữ liệu mà Server gửi đến.

Bao gồm:

  • Hiển thị Chunk.
  • Hiển thị Mob và Entity.
  • Thanh máu, thanh đói, giáp.
  • Âm thanh và nhạc nền.
  • Giao diện người dùng (HUD).
  • MiniMap.
  • Shader.
  • Texture Pack.
  • Các Mod hiển thị khác.

Có thể hiểu đơn giản:

Server-side xử lý dữ liệu, còn Client-side hiển thị dữ liệu.


Vì sao Client-side lại quan trọng?

Hiểu rõ Client-side sẽ giúp bạn tránh được rất nhiều nhầm lẫn khi cài Mod hoặc xử lý các vấn đề về hiệu năng.


1. Cài đặt Mod đúng cách

Không phải Mod nào cũng cài trên Server.

Hiện nay Mod thường chia thành ba loại:

  • Chỉ chạy trên Client.
  • Chỉ chạy trên Server.
  • Chạy trên cả Client và Server.

Nếu bạn vô tình cài một Client-side Mod lên Server (ví dụ các Mod Zoom hoặc thay đổi giao diện), máy chủ có thể không khởi động được hoặc bị Crash.

Nguyên nhân là Server không có khả năng hiển thị đồ họa hay nhận thao tác bàn phím, chuột như Client.


2. Phân biệt lag Client và lag Server

Rất nhiều người chơi đều gọi chung là "lag", nhưng thực tế Minecraft có hai loại lag hoàn toàn khác nhau.

Client-side Lag

Đây là hiện tượng:

  • FPS thấp.
  • Giật hình.
  • Render Chunk chậm.
  • Shader quá nặng.

Những vấn đề này chỉ xảy ra trên máy tính của bạn.


Server-side Lag

Bao gồm:

  • Đào Block bị trễ.
  • Mob giật lùi (Rubber Band).
  • TPS thấp.
  • Chat phản hồi chậm.
  • Tất cả người chơi đều cảm nhận được độ trễ.

Lúc này nguyên nhân nằm ở Server hoặc đường truyền mạng.

Ví dụ:

Nếu chỉ riêng bạn bật Shader và FPS giảm xuống còn 20 nhưng người khác vẫn chơi bình thường, đó là Client-side Lag.

Nếu toàn bộ người chơi đều thấy Mob đứng yên hoặc Block phản hồi chậm thì đó là Server-side Lag.


3. Đảm bảo tính công bằng khi chơi

Rất nhiều Mod Client-side chỉ giúp cải thiện trải nghiệm mà không làm thay đổi gameplay.

Ví dụ:

  • Tăng FPS.
  • Hiển thị HUD đẹp hơn.
  • Tooltip chi tiết hơn.
  • MiniMap.
  • Shader.

Tuy nhiên, cũng có những Client Mod phục vụ mục đích gian lận.

Ví dụ:

  • X-Ray.
  • Aimbot.
  • Auto Click.
  • Kill Aura.
  • ESP.

Những Mod này không thay đổi dữ liệu của Server, nhưng chúng thay đổi cách Client hiển thị hoặc tự động hóa thao tác của người chơi.

Vì vậy nhiều máy chủ sẽ sử dụng Anti Cheat để phát hiện và ngăn chặn các Client Mod gian lận.


Những Client-side Mod phổ biến

Có rất nhiều Mod chỉ cần cài trên máy tính của người chơi mà không cần cài trên Server.
20260702_HcqZdITCcKiROW407l2b.webp
Một số Mod nổi tiếng gồm:

Tối ưu hiệu năng

  • Sodium
  • OptiFine
  • Iris Shaders
  • FerriteCore
  • ImmediatelyFast

Giúp:

  • Tăng FPS.
  • Hỗ trợ Shader.
  • Cải thiện hiệu năng.

MiniMap

  • Xaero's Minimap
  • JourneyMap
  • VoxelMap

Hiển thị:

  • Bản đồ.
  • Waypoint.
  • Vị trí người chơi.
    20260702_zBXJxGjJO7hFRgImBF2v.png

HUD

Các Mod hiển thị thêm:

  • FPS.
  • Ping.
  • Độ bền giáp.
  • Hiệu ứng Potion.
  • Tình trạng trang bị.

    20260702_2I9XLCBGowXvOIPD8Ln9.png

Thay đổi giao diện

Một số Mod giúp:

  • Thay đổi Font chữ.
  • Giao diện tối (Dark Mode).
  • Hiển thị mô tả Enchantment.
  • Thay đổi Texture.
  • Hiển thị Item đẹp hơn.

Những Mod này chỉ thay đổi giao diện trên máy của bạn và không ảnh hưởng đến Server.

20260702_JYKJi8AP4k9XlpnqTHok.png


Client-side Mod có ảnh hưởng đến người chơi khác không?

Không.

Một Client-side Mod đúng nghĩa chỉ thay đổi những gì bạn nhìn thấy hoặc cách Minecraft hoạt động trên máy tính của riêng bạn.

Ví dụ:

  • Bạn dùng Shader nhưng người khác không thấy.
  • Bạn dùng MiniMap nhưng người khác không có.
  • Bạn tăng FPS nhưng người khác không được hưởng.

Mọi thay đổi đều chỉ diễn ra trên Client của bạn.


Làm sao để biết Mod là Client-side?

Hiện nay hầu hết các Mod đều ghi rõ trong phần mô tả:

  • Client
  • Server
  • Client & Server

Nếu không thấy ghi, bạn có thể áp dụng quy tắc đơn giản sau:

Thường là Client-side nếu Mod:

  • Chỉ thay đổi giao diện.
  • Tăng FPS.
  • Thay đổi HUD.
  • Thêm Shader.
  • MiniMap.
  • Zoom.
  • Font chữ.
  • Texture.

Thường cần cài cả Client và Server nếu Mod:

  • Thêm Block.
  • Thêm Item.
  • Thêm Mob.
  • Thêm Dimension.
  • Thêm cơ chế chơi mới.
  • Thay đổi Gameplay.

Nếu chưa chắc chắn, hãy luôn đọc hướng dẫn của tác giả Mod trước khi cài đặt để tránh lỗi hoặc xung đột trên máy chủ.